namespace OCA\FaceRecognition\Helper;
use OCA\FaceRecognition\Service\SettingsService;
/**
* Tries to get total amount of memory on the host, given to PHP.
*/
class MemoryLimits {
/**
* Tries to get memory available to PHP. This is highly speculative business.
* It will first try reading value of "memory_limit" and if it is -1, it will
* try to get 1/2 memory of host system. In case of any error, it will return
* negative value. Note that negative here doesn't mean "unlimited"! This
* function doesn't care if PHP is being used in CLI or FPM mode.
*
* @return float Total memory available to PHP, in bytes, or negative if
* we don't know any better
*/
public static function getAvailableMemory(): float {
// Try first to get from php.ini
$availableMemory = MemoryLimits::getPhpMemory();
// php.ini says that memory_limit is -1, which means unlimited.
// We need to get memory from system (if OS is supported here).
// Only linux is currently supported.
if ($availableMemory < 0) {
$systemMemory = MemoryLimits::getSystemMemory();
if ($systemMemory < 0)
return -1;
$availableMemory = ($systemMemory * 2 / 3);
$availableMemory = min($availableMemory, SettingsService::MAXIMUN_ASSIGNED_MEMORY);
}
return $availableMemory;
}
/**
* Tries to get memory available to PHP reading value of "memory_limit".
*
* @return float Total memory available to PHP, in bytes, or negative if
* we don't know any better or it is unlimited.
*/
public static function getPhpMemory(): float {
// Get from php.ini
try {
$ini_value = ini_get('memory_limit');
$availableMemory = MemoryLimits::returnBytes($ini_value);
} catch (\Exception $e) {
$availableMemory = -1;
}
return $availableMemory;
}
/**
* @return float Total memory available on system, in bytes, or negative if
* we don't know any better
* Only linux is currently supported.
*/
public static function getSystemMemory(): float {
if (php_uname("s") !== "Linux")
return -1;
$linuxMemory = MemoryLimits::getTotalMemoryLinux();
if ($linuxMemory <= 0) {
return -2;
}
return $linuxMemory;
}
/**
* @return float Total memory available on linux system, in bytes, or
* zero if we don't know any better.
*/
private static function getTotalMemoryLinux(): float {
$fh = fopen('/proc/meminfo','r');
if ($fh === false) {
return 0;
}
$mem = 0;
while ($line = fgets($fh)) {
$pieces = array();
if (preg_match('/^MemTotal:\s+(\d+)\skB$/', $line, $pieces)) {
$mem = $pieces[1];
break;
}
}
fclose($fh);
return $mem * 1024;
}
/**
* Converts shorthand memory notation value to bytes
* From http://php.net/manual/en/function.ini-get.php
*
* @param string $val Memory size shorthand notation string
*
* @return int Value in integers (bytes)
*/
public static function returnBytes(string $val): int {
$val = trim($val);
if ($val === "") {
return 0;
}
$valInt = intval($val);
if ($valInt === 0) {
return 0;
}
$last = strtolower($val[strlen($val)-1]);
switch($last) {
case 'g':
$valInt *= 1024;
// Fallthrough on purpose
case 'm':
$valInt *= 1024;
// Fallthrough on purpose
case 'k':
$valInt *= 1024;
}
return $valInt;
}
}
